“If it doesn’t sell, it isn’t creative†– a quote from David Ogilvy, one of the world’s foremost advertising geniuses who in 1948 founded “Hewitt, Ogilvy, Benson & Mather, which later became Ogilvy & Mather. By the 1960’s, the agency quickly established itself as a worldwide leader through a policy of building brands through advertising. [...]

The legendary opera tenor, Luciano Pavarotti, has died of pancreatic cancer. He was 71. His last days were spent at home with his family by his side.
Born in the heart of opera country, Modena, Italy near Milan with its renowned opera house, La Scala, Luciano Pavarotti grew up with a father who was a baker [...]
